如何指定端口访问服务器

fiy 其他 107

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要指定端口访问服务器,您可以使用以下方法:

    1. 在URL中指定端口:在访问服务器的URL中添加冒号和端口号。例如,如果服务器IP是192.168.0.1,端口号是8080,则URL应为http://192.168.0.1:8080。

    2. 使用命令行工具:如果您使用的是命令行工具如cURL,可以使用"-p"或"–port"参数指定端口。例如,使用命令"curl -p 8080 http://192.168.0.1"来访问端口号为8080的服务器。

    3. 在代码中指定端口:如果您是通过编程语言访问服务器,可以在代码中指定需要访问的端口。具体的方法取决于您使用的编程语言和框架。以下是一些常用编程语言中指定端口的示例代码:

    • 在Java中,使用HttpURLConnection类或HttpClient库时,可以通过设置连接的URL对象的端口属性来指定端口。示例如下:
    URL url = new URL("http://192.168.0.1");
    HttpURLConnection connection = (HttpURLConnection) url.openConnection();
    connection.setPort(8080);
    
    • 在Python中,使用requests库进行HTTP请求时,可以通过指定url的端口参数来访问指定端口的服务器。示例如下:
    import requests
    response = requests.get("http://192.168.0.1:8080")
    
    • 在Node.js中,使用axios库进行HTTP请求时,可以在请求的配置中指定端口号。示例如下:
    const axios = require('axios');
    axios.get('http://192.168.0.1:8080')
      .then(response => {
        console.log(response.data);
      })
      .catch(error => {
        console.error(error);
      });
    

    通过以上方法,您可以指定端口访问服务器。请确保服务器已配置允许指定端口的访问,并且服务器和客户端之间的网络连接正常。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要指定端口访问服务器,可以采取以下几种方法:

    1. 在浏览器中直接指定端口:通常情况下,浏览器默认使用80端口来访问网站,如果需要指定其他端口访问服务器,可以在访问网址后面加上冒号和端口号,例如:http://example.com:8080,其中8080为指定的端口号。

    2. 修改服务器配置文件:如果是自己搭建的服务器,可以通过修改服务器的配置文件来指定端口。不同的服务器软件有不同的配置文件,常见的如Apache服务器的配置文件为httpd.conf,Nginx服务器的配置文件为nginx.conf,通过修改相应配置文件中的端口号来指定访问服务器的端口。

    3. 使用反向代理:可以通过使用反向代理服务器来指定访问服务器的端口。反向代理服务器会将客户端的请求转发到指定的服务器上,并且可以指定转发的端口号。通过配置反向代理服务器,可以将客户端的请求转发到指定服务器的指定端口上。

    4. 使用防火墙或路由器端口映射:如果服务器是在局域网内,可以通过设置防火墙或路由器的端口映射来指定访问服务器的端口。通过设置端口映射,可以将公网的请求转发到局域网内指定服务器的指定端口上。

    5. 使用DNS解析:如果需要通过域名访问服务器,并且要指定端口,可以通过使用DNS解析来指定访问服务器的端口。通过修改域名的DNS解析记录,将指定的端口与域名进行绑定,这样就可以通过域名访问服务器的指定端口。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要指定端口访问服务器,有以下几种方法:

    方法一:直接在URL中指定端口号访问
    在URL中直接加上端口号,格式为“http://ip地址:端口号”,例如“http://192.168.1.100:8080”,表示访问IP地址为192.168.1.100的服务器的8080端口。

    方法二:修改服务器的监听端口号
    在服务器配置文件中修改监听端口号。具体操作方法如下:

    1. 打开服务器的配置文件,例如:Apache服务器的配置文件是httpd.conf,Nginx服务器的配置文件是nginx.conf等。
    2. 在配置文件中找到监听端口号的设置项,通常是“Listen”或“server”关键字,后面跟着端口号。例如,Apache服务器的监听端口号配置项是“Listen 80”。
    3. 将端口号修改为所需的端口号,保存配置文件。
    4. 重启服务器,使配置生效。

    方法三:使用专门的工具进行端口映射
    使用专门的工具,如frp(https://github.com/fatedier/frp)或ngrok(https://ngrok.com/),进行端口映射。这些工具可以将公网IP的指定端口映射到内网服务器的指定端口,实现通过公网IP和指定端口访问服务器的功能。
    使用这些工具通常需要在服务器上安装对应的软件,并进行相应的配置。

    方法四:配置路由器端口转发
    如果服务器在局域网内,要通过公网IP和指定端口访问服务器,需要在路由器上进行端口转发配置。具体操作方法如下:

    1. 登录路由器的管理界面。
    2. 找到“端口转发”或“端口映射”的设置项。
    3. 添加一条新的端口转发规则,将公网IP的指定端口映射到服务器的指定端口。
    4. 保存配置,并重启路由器,使配置生效。
      配置完成后,就可以通过公网IP和指定端口访问服务器了。

    总结
    以上是指定端口访问服务器的几种常用方法:直接在URL中指定端口号、修改服务器监听端口号、使用专门的工具进行端口映射、配置路由器端口转发。根据实际情况选择适合的方法进行配置即可。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部